tests

 

Tests are sometimes recommended to provide information about the root causes of health problems. By pin pointing metabolic imbalances we are able to ensure that your personal programme is specific and tailored to your needs. Taking tests often results in clients reaching their goals more quickly and effectively. Many people also enjoy having the reassurance that a scientific test gives.

 

Some tests can be arranged through your G.P. We also work with highly reputable private laboratories if we require further information.

There is a comprehensive range of profiles available which assess key areas such as:

  • immune response
  • nutritional status
  • hormonal health
  • digestive problems
  • cardiovascular risk
  • toxic elements exposure
  • cellular energy and liver function

Some common tests include:

  • food allergy/intolerance
  • full thyroid screen
  • liver function (phase 1 + 2 pathways)
  • microbial infection
  • adrenal stress index
  • digestive analysis
  • cellular energy
  • comprehensive female and male hormone panel
  • full cardiovascular risk assessment (including homocysteine) and nutrient status
